Hazrat Umme Ummaarah (ra) was born in Madinah, around 40 years before hijrah, the migration of the Holy Prophet (sas) from Makkah to Madinah.1 She belonged to a respectable family in the Madinah tribe of Khizraj called Najjaar.2 The Holy Prophet (sas) was very attached to the Najjaar because his (sas) great-grandmother (Hazrat Abdul Muttalib’s mother) belonged to this clan.3
